At the A1 level, you don't need to use '검증하다' often, but it's good to know it means a 'very serious check.' Imagine you have a toy and you want to see if it really works by dropping it or putting it in water. That 'testing' is like '검증하다.' In simple Korean, we usually use '확인하다' (check). If you want to say 'I checked my homework,' you say '숙제를 확인했어요.' You wouldn't use '검증하다' here because homework isn't a scientific theory. Just remember: '검증하다' is for scientists, police, and big bosses who need to be 100% sure about something important using a test.
At the A2 level, you can start to distinguish between a simple check and a 'verification.' '검증하다' is a word you might see in news headlines or on TV. It means to test something to see if it is true or safe. For example, if a new phone comes out, people '검증' the battery to make sure it doesn't explode. You can think of it as 'Test + Check.' It's a formal word. When you study for the TOPIK exam, you might see this word in reading passages about science or technology. It's used when someone makes a big claim and others want to see if they are telling the truth.
At the B1 level, you should begin using '검증하다' in formal writing or discussions. This word is essential for talking about experiments, research, or professional skills. For instance, in a job interview context, a company might '검증' your Korean skills through a test. It's more than just a quick look; it's a systematic process. You'll often see the passive form '검증되다' (to be verified). For example, '이 방법은 효과가 검증되었습니다' (This method's effectiveness has been verified). This sounds much more professional than just saying 'it's good.' Use it when you want to sound objective and reliable.
At the B2 level, '검증하다' is a key vocabulary item for academic and professional fluency. You should understand its nuances compared to '입증하다' (to prove) and '증명하다' (to certify). '검증하다' specifically refers to the *process* of verification—the act of putting a hypothesis or a system through a series of rigorous tests to check its validity. In a B2 level discussion about social issues, you might talk about '인사 검증' (personnel vetting) for politicians or '사실 검증' (fact-checking) in journalism. It implies a critical approach where one does not take information at face value but seeks empirical evidence.
At the C1 level, you should be able to use '검증하다' in complex sentence structures and understand its application in specialized fields like law, philosophy, and high-level data science. In law, '현장 검증' refers to the judicial inspection of a crime scene. In science, '가설 검증' (hypothesis testing) involves statistical significance and methodology. You should also be aware of collocations like '검증 절차' (verification procedure) and '검증을 거치다' (to go through verification). At this level, you use the word to discuss the epistemological foundations of a claim—how do we know what we know, and has it been subjected to sufficient scrutiny?
At the C2 level, '검증하다' is used with absolute precision. You understand that it is the cornerstone of the scientific method and systemic integrity. You can discuss the '재검증' (re-verification) of historical facts or the '교차 검증' (cross-verification/triangulation) of data sources in complex research. You might use it in philosophical debates about the '검증 가능성 원리' (Verification Principle). At this level, the word is not just about checking; it's about the systemic validation of truth-claims within a specific framework. You can use it to critique the lack of '검증' in populist rhetoric or to advocate for more rigorous '시스템 검증' in critical infrastructure.

The Korean verb 검증하다 (Geom-jeung-ha-da) is a sophisticated term that translates primarily to 'to verify,' 'to validate,' or 'to cross-examine.' At its core, it refers to the rigorous process of determining whether a claim, a theory, a fact, or a product is true, accurate, or functional through systematic investigation or empirical testing. Unlike the simpler word '확인하다' (to check), 검증하다 implies a formal, often scientific or legal, standard of proof. It is not just looking at something; it is subjecting it to a trial or a series of tests to ensure its integrity.

Etymological Root
The word is composed of two Hanja characters: 檢 (검), meaning 'to examine' or 'to inspect,' and 證 (증), meaning 'evidence' or 'proof.' Together, they signify the act of using evidence to inspect the validity of something.
Semantic Range
It covers scientific validation (experimental results), judicial verification (evidence in court), and technical certification (software testing or safety checks).
Intensity of Action
It suggests a high level of scrutiny. If you '검증' a person's character, you aren't just meeting them; you are investigating their past and background to ensure they are who they say they are.

"새로운 백신의 효능을 검증하기 위해 수천 명을 대상으로 임상 시험을 실시했다."

— (Clinical trials were conducted on thousands of people to verify the efficacy of the new vaccine.)

In modern Korean society, this word is frequently used in the context of '청문회' (hearings) for high-ranking officials, where their qualifications and ethics are '검증' (verified). It carries a weight of responsibility and objectivity. When a scientist claims a breakthrough, the scientific community must 검증하다 the results through peer review and replication. This process is the backbone of the scientific method.

"이 가설은 아직 실험을 통해 검증되지 않았습니다."

— (This hypothesis has not yet been verified through experiments.)

Furthermore, in the digital age, '팩트 체크' (fact-checking) is essentially the act of 검증하다 applied to news and social media. It involves looking for primary sources, cross-referencing data, and ensuring that information has not been manipulated. The term is also vital in the tech industry, specifically in '검증 및 타당성 확인' (Verification and Validation - V&V), which ensures software meets specifications and fulfills its intended purpose.

Using 검증하다 correctly requires understanding its formal tone and its typical grammatical objects. It is almost exclusively used with abstract nouns that represent claims, theories, abilities, or facts. You rarely '검증' a physical object like a chair unless you are testing its structural integrity or safety standards.

1. Common Object Pairings

  • 가설 (Hypothesis): 가설을 검증하다 (To test/verify a hypothesis).
  • 이론 (Theory): 이론의 타당성을 검증하다 (To verify the validity of a theory).
  • 능력 (Ability/Capability): 실무 능력을 검증하다 (To verify practical skills).
  • 사실 (Fact): 사실 여부를 검증하다 (To verify whether something is a fact).
  • 보안 (Security): 시스템 보안을 검증하다 (To verify system security).

"전문가들은 그 기술의 실용성을 철저히 검증했습니다."

(Experts thoroughly verified the practicality of that technology.)

2. Passive vs. Active Forms

In academic and technical writing, the passive form 검증되다 (to be verified) is extremely common. It shifts the focus from the person doing the testing to the result of the test itself.

Active:
과학자들이 데이터를 검증했다. (Scientists verified the data.)
Passive:
데이터가 과학자들에 의해 검증되었다. (The data was verified by scientists.)

3. Contextual Nuances

In a corporate setting, 검증하다 often appears during the hiring process or performance reviews. It implies a deep dive into a candidate's portfolio or a project's ROI. In politics, it refers to '인사 검증' (personnel vetting), where a candidate's entire life is scrutinized for potential scandals.

You will encounter 검증하다 in environments where accuracy and truth are paramount. It is a staple of formal Korean discourse.

1. News and Journalism

News anchors often use this word when discussing investigative reports. "우리는 제보자의 주장을 검증하기 위해 현장을 방문했습니다" (We visited the site to verify the informant's claim). It signals to the audience that the news outlet is performing its due diligence.

2. Academic and Scientific Research

In any research paper (논문), the methodology section will discuss how the variables were '검증' (verified). The term '가설 검증' (hypothesis testing) is a fundamental concept in statistics and social sciences.

"본 연구는 제안된 모델의 효율성을 검증하는 데 목적이 있다."

(The purpose of this study is to verify the efficiency of the proposed model.)

3. Legal and Political Settings

During court proceedings, evidence must be '검증'. This might involve a '현장 검증' (on-site inspection/reconstruction of a crime). In politics, the '인사 검증 시스템' (personnel vetting system) is a frequent topic of debate regarding government appointments.

4. Business and Technology

In the tech world, '검증' is part of the QA (Quality Assurance) process. Before a product is launched, its safety, performance, and security must be '검증' to prevent failures. Terms like '기술 검증' (Proof of Concept - PoC) are common in B2B transactions.

Because 검증하다 has several close synonyms, learners often struggle with choosing the right word for the right context. Here are the most frequent pitfalls.

1. Overusing it for Simple Tasks

As mentioned, '검증하다' is for rigorous processes. Using it for checking your watch or checking if you have your keys is incorrect.

  • 숙제를 다 했는지 검증해 봐. (Verify if you finished your homework.) - Too formal.
  • 숙제를 다 했는지 확인해 봐. (Check if you finished your homework.)

2. Confusing '검증하다' with '입증하다'

While similar, 입증하다 (Ip-jeung-ha-da) means 'to prove' or 'to substantiate.' '검증' is the process of testing, while '입증' is the successful result of showing something is true.

검증 (Verification):
Testing the hypothesis (could be true or false).
입증 (Proof):
Successfully showing the hypothesis is true.

3. Confusing '검증하다' with '증명하다'

증명하다 (Jeung-myeong-ha-da) is often used for logical or mathematical proofs, or for providing certificates (e.g., '재학 증명서' - certificate of enrollment). '검증' is more empirical and investigative.

Error Example:

"이 수학 공식을 검증하세요." (Verify this math formula.)

Better: "이 수학 공식을 증명하세요." (Prove this math formula.)

To truly master 검증하다, you must understand its neighbors in the semantic field of 'checking and proving.'

확인하다 (Confirm/Check)

The most common and versatile word. Used for checking facts, status, or physical presence. Low intensity.

입증하다 (Substantiate/Prove)

Used when you have evidence to support a claim. Often used in legal or argumentative contexts.

증명하다 (Prove/Certify)

Focuses on logical certainty or official certification. Common in math, logic, and official documents.

실증하다 (Demonstrate with Facts)

To prove something through actual examples or practical experience. Very empirical.

대조하다 (Compare/Cross-check)

To verify by comparing two different things (e.g., comparing a signature with an ID).

심사하다 (Screen/Judge)

To examine and evaluate based on certain criteria, often for a competition or application.

Origine du mot

Sino-Korean origin, used historically in legal and administrative contexts.

Contexte culturel

There is a growing trend of 'fact-checking' (팩트 체크) in Korean social media to '검증' viral rumors.

Korean universities place high value on '검증된' research, often preferring international journals (SCI) for verification.

The 'Hearing' (청문회) culture in Korea is centered around the '검증' of candidates.
